AxQM: A Textbook-Scale Benchmark for Formal Proof Synthesis in a Library of Finite-Dimensional Quantum Mechanics
תקציר מקורי באנגליתarXiv:2609.05157v1 Announce Type: cross Abstract: Formalizing mathematics in a proof assistant, where a machine checks every definition, statement and proof, has set a new standard of rigor. Large language models are now capable of formalizing autonomously, even at the scale of whole textbooks. We bring this standard of rigor to physics, where theoretical arguments carry idealizations that are rarely stated fully, and any logical gaps could have a cascading effect on interdependent results. Recognizing the need to evaluate autoformalization systems for physics, we release AxQM, 1,019 kernel-checkable proof-synthesis tasks over 479 items drawn from the textbook Quantum Computation and Quantum Information by Nielsen and Chuang.
